Following Ruby Rose's departure, Gotham city has found its new 'Batwoman'.

Javicia Leslie will see a brand new iteration of the infamous Batwoman appear on our screens in the near future, picking up the mantle from the series' previous star, Ruby Rose.

Leslie will play a new character in the title role of the CW superhero series, which will see her portray a "highly skilled and wildly undisciplined" character named Ryan Wilder. Leslie is relatively unknown but has had some brief appearances in a number of productions including the 'MacGyver' reboot with Lucas Till.

"I am extremely proud to be the first Black actress to play the iconic role of Batwoman on television, and as a bisexual woman, I am honoured to join this groundbreaking show which has been such a trailblazer for the LGBTQ+ community," Leslie said.

Ruby Rose famously exited the series earlier this year, after only appearing on the show for its first season. Rose's depiction of the iconic Kate Kane/Batwoman persona wasn't very well received by fans, and her costume was also slated to the high heavens. Following her exit, producers of the series were keen to find another member of the LGBTQ community to play the vicious vigilante.

Following the new casting news however, Rose posted a photo of Leslie on Instagram, exclaiming her delight: "OMG!! This is amazing!! I am so glad Batwoman will be played by an amazing Black woman. I want to congratulate Javicia Leslie on taking over the bat cape. You are walking into an amazing cast and crew. I can’t wait to watch season 2 you are going to be amazing!!"

We're looking forward to seeing what fresh superhero anarchy Javicia Leslie can breath into this new 'Batwoman' in the future.